5 Tips for Protecting Your Indoor Air Quality During Cold and Flu Season 

1. Try a UV Germicidal Lamp 

UV lamps target microorganisms including carriers of the flu. Bacteria and other organic particles are sterilized in strong ultraviolet light, preventing them from reproducing your air quality. 

2. Adjust Indoor Humidity with a Humidifier/Dehumidifier  

Both excessive and insufficient humidity can cause problems with your air quality. For instance, dry air can bother your skin or sinuses, while moist air may promote mold and mildew. A humidifier or dehumidifier maintains your home’s humidity in optimum balance for a more complete sense of comfort. 

3. Clean or Replace Your Air Filters Consistently 

Your HVAC system’s air filter is a crucial component for both air quality and general comfort. If you fail to clean or replace it, you might notice a drop in performance. Aging air filters can become blocked, allowing more airborne particles to circulate. Specially designed models like HEPA filters can be great options for households with allergies or other respiratory concerns.
